The MM12 Underground/Underwater Resin Casting Waterproof Cable Junction Box is a cast resin straight-through joint engineered for polymeric cables and conductors. Designed for harsh installation environments, it serves commercial users across municipal engineering, water conservancy, industrial facility construction and outdoor power distribution projects. The product supports both compression and screw connectors on copper and aluminium conductors, adapting to varied on-site construction conditions and low-voltage cable connection demands.
This junction box features compact dimensions, fitting installation in narrow spaces such as cable ducts and buried pipelines. Its transparent shockproof plastic shell keeps the splice area visible before casting, allowing construction personnel to confirm connection status before resin pouring and reduce rework risk. The product is designed with a large filler aperture, which streamlines resin casting operation and cuts down on-site construction time. Its split mould structure enables quick assembly, which saves working hours and reduces labor costs for commercial projects.
The cable junction box resists chemical agents and alkaline earth elements, maintaining stable performance when exposed to soil and corrosive substances. Its material is stabilized against UV rays, supporting long-term outdoor deployment without performance degradation. The product achieves longitudinally and transversely water-tight performance, adapting to underground burial and underwater immersion scenarios, and preventing water ingress from damaging internal cable connections.
This resin casting joint delivers electrical insulating properties compatible with 0.6/1kV low-voltage systems, supporting stable operation of cable lines. It has high mechanical strength, protecting internal cable splices from external extrusion and impact during burial and installation. The product supports immediate operation after resin casting, which helps shorten overall project construction cycles.
This waterproof cable junction box applies to a wide range of scenarios, including indoor premises, outdoor facilities, underground burial, underwater environments and installation ducts. It fits low-voltage power distribution systems, outdoor lighting circuits, underground municipal cable networks, underwater landscape facilities and industrial plant wiring projects. The product is universally suitable for connecting polymeric cables or conductors insulated with PVC, PE, XLPE and EPR (e.g. N(A)YY, NYM, TT). It works with both copper and aluminium conductors, and supports compression or screw type connection terminals. The junction box has a rated voltage level of Uo/U (Um) 0.6/1 (1.2) kV, covering most low-voltage power distribution demands for commercial and industrial applications.
Remove steps from the end of the mould. The opening must be slightly larger than the cable diameter (approx. 1 - 2 mm).
Insert the cable sheath: for cable diameter φ <20mm, insertion length a = 2 × c; for φ >20mm, insertion length a = 40 mm.
Install connectors on cable conductors.
Roughen, degrease and clean the cable sheaths to ensure tight bonding with cast resin.
Centre the splice: the distance between the connectors, between the conductors themselves, and the distance of each splice from the mould must be at least 5 mm.
Snap the two mould halves together to fix the position.
Seal mould ends with PVC tape to prevent resin leakage during the pouring process.
Mix the cast resin and fill it in according to separate instructions, up to 3 mm from the upper edge of the filler opening.
Insert the cover onto the filler opening.
Energize the cables: cables with voltage up to 1 kV can be energized immediately after casting. For cables with core insulation made of PE, VPE, EPR and similar materials, add an extra step: roughen, degrease and clean the cable insulation before assembling the mould.
For PILC cables with armouring and jute: insert 20 mm of armouring into the mould; do not insert any jute section into the mould. For PILC cables with synthetic sheath: roughen, degrease and clean the cable sheath, then insert 20 mm of the sheath into the mould. Insert the lead sheath according to the insertion length rule described in step 2. Roughen, degrease and clean the lead sheath and armouring thoroughly immediately before locking the mould halves. Remove insulating material completely from the conductor and belt insulation. For fluid insulating material: cover the filler and paper insulation with Oilstop/Adhesive agent before resin casting.
